Jenny Craig ANZ business placed in administration

Jenny Craig’s Australian and New Zealand subsidiaries have appointed administrators after the collapse of the US parent.

The US arm of the business has entered Chapter 7 proceedings and filed for bankruptcy, unable to repay a loan.

The Australian and New Zealand companies subsequently appointed voluntary administrators Vaughan Strawbridge, Kate Warwick, and Joseph Hansell of FTI Consulting to restructure the business.

Strawbridge said it was “unfortunate” that an overseas parent company entering bankruptcy impacted the local business even though they operated independently from each other.

“We are working with the Australian and New Zealand leadership team to trade the businesses with a view to attracting new capital to restructure the companies.

“Interest has already been received and we will be working with those parties and stakeholders of the business to secure the ongoing business and provide clarity to its loyal and committed staff and customers as soon as possible.”

The administrators intend to continue to trade the Jenny Craig ANZ businesses while the restructuring continued.
